Staff Nurse

Lennoxtown, SCT, GB, United Kingdom

Job Description

Reporting to: Manager and deputy



Main responsibilities



Organise and plan work schedules taking into consideration residents' needs and priorities and provide highest possible levels of care by supporting/assisting Residents, when required, with all aspects of daily living.

Support the induction of new Staff Members and supervision of all Carers in all aspects of their work in the home.

Oversee the hydration/nutritional needs of residents, monitor skin integrity and ensure prescribed positional changes take place.

Ensure individualised resident documentation is completed and recorded accurately in a timely manner.

Assist Residents in all aspects of their care needs (e.g. physical, emotional and spiritual). Provide supervision and attention when needed, ensuring Residents retain their comfort and dignity.

Develop strong communication between the other nursing teams.

Ensure full privacy and dignity is maintained for the dying and the bereaved, in line with the company's policies and procedures supporting junior members of staff.

Participate in Staff and Client meetings as and when required - support nurses in care review meetings - CHC assessments.

Maintain professional knowledge and competence - develop areas of good practice for discussion with Manager/Deputy.

Attend mandatory training days/courses, and an additional course appropriate to resident's needs and extending knowledge to other team members improving implemented care/needs to residents.

Understand, and ensure the implementation of, the Homes Health and Safety policy, and Emergency and Fire procedures.

Report to the Deputy/Administrator any faulty appliances, damaged furniture, equipment or any potential hazard.

Promote safe working practice within the Home including completion of accurate documentation and monitoring of documentation that reflects resident's health status.

Ensure that all information of a confidential nature gained in the course of duty is not divulged to a third party.

Oversee the monitoring of Residents who may be confused and/or who have behavioural problems.

Oversee the promotion of continence and pro-actively refer to appropriate third party professionals as and when required.

Assist in the delivery of care for Residents who are dying or who have a progressive illness. Assist with last offices.

Complete, observe & review care planning needs for Residents, and complete written daily records as instructed and in line with the Company's policies and procedures.

Carry out medication administration in line with Policy, including ordering, returns and reviews with GP and other health professionals.

Answer Nurse Call system, giving assistance as required. Answer the door and telephone appropriately. Respond accordingly, and pass on messages promptly.

Report on well-being of Residents and liaise with GPs and Support Managers etc.

Make Visitors feel welcome. Provide refreshments/assistance as and when required.

Ensure the Care Centre and treatment rooms are kept clean and tidy, in line with the Company's attention to detail philosophy.

Make sure that residents who need assistance at meal times are being supervised and assisted as needed by the care team.

Practice maximum integrity in all dealings with Residents' personal and financial affairs, and avoid abuse of the privileged relationship that exists with Residents.

Ensure all holistic assessments are carried out when Residents are admitted to the Care Centre e.g. covering nutritional and incontinence issues, risk assessment etc.

Report immediately to the Home Manager, or Person in Charge, any illness of an infectious nature or accident incurred by a Client, colleague, self or another.

Understand, and ensure the implementation of, the Care Centre's Health and Safety policy, and Emergency and Fire procedures.

Promote and ensure the good reputation of the Care Centre.

Notify the Home Manager, or the Person in Charge, as soon as possible of your inability to report for duty, and also on your return to work from all periods of absence.

Ensure the security of the Care Centre is maintained at all times.

Adhere to all Company policies and procedures within the defined timescales.

Ensure all equipment that is used by you is clean and well maintained.

Liaise with external professional's e.g., social workers, GPs and other professionals.
